Is 'Friending' in Your Future? Better Pay Your Taxes First

August 27th, 2009 — 6:36am

Tax deadbeats are finding someone actually reads their MySpace and Facebook postings: the taxman.
State revenue agents have begun nabbing scofflaws by mining information posted on social-networking Web sites, from relocation announcements to professional profiles to financial boasts.
